LiquidTransport.cpp and LiquidTransport.h

Replaced viscosityModel_ member with m_viscMixModel.

Fixed bug in filling m_coeffVisc_Ns, etc., for the Arrhenius model.
Failed to use "push_back() to add to vector prior to this.  

For temperature-dependence option LTR_MODEL_POLY, corrected the
polynomial evaluations to correctly account for number of terms in the
polynomial. 

Viscosity mixture evaluations are now up to date with respect to the
use of LTR_MIXMODEL_MOLEFRACS and LTR_MIXMODEL_LOG_MOLEFRACS.

Added membersto hold activity coefficient info
    vector_fp actCoeffMolar_;
    vector_fp lnActCoeffMolarDelta_;

Added method  
getSpeciesFluxesES(...,const doublereal* grad_Phi,doublereal* fluxes))
that takes electrostatic potential gradient in addition to other gradients.
This then calls getSpeciesFluxesExt() to do the work.

Added new version of method LiquidTransport::update_Grad_lnAC().  The
new version calls m_thermo->getdlnActCoeffdlnX( DATA_PTR(grad_lnAC) );
These routines in the thermo object need to be provided.
